The Salesforce Specialist will provide Salesforce application support to MED-Project on
a temporary basis. The Salesforce Specialist is expected to provide support for day-to day Salesforce administrative functions including performing basic updates,
add/deactivate u , monitor access levels, add basic custom fields, address user
issues as they arise, clean and upload data. The Salesforce Specialist will support
members of the MED-Project Salesforce team, including the Senior Salesforce
Administrator and Salesforce Developers, as they implement new innovations to solve
novel business challenges. The Salesforce Specialist may also provide support to the
Data Services Project Management (DSPM) team by monitoring and addressing daily
Salesforce requests and issues, as well as, assisting with project tasks assigned during
sprints.
This position requires excellent technical and communication skills as it interacts with all
levels of the organization. The Salesforce Specialist operates under the oversight and
directly reports to the Senior Director, Data Services and Project Management Center of
Excellence.

Required Skills & Experience

Create and Manage Changes to Salesforce

Create and maintain fields, objects, reports, dashboards, and other Salesforce
features.
Support existing reporting requirements and respond to ad-hoc reporting
requests from internal employees.
Document associated processes, procedures, and job aids in support of industry
best practices.
Perform related duties as assigned or requested in daily tickets.
Maintain System Security and Integrity through Credential Administration
Reassign Accounts in response to personnel changes.
Grant / remove and maintain user licenses.
Reset passwords and troubleshoot log-in issues.
Maintain security including sharing rules, permission sets, profile permissions,
etc.

Support implementation of new business process and systems

Work with the Data Services Project Management (DSPM) team, Salesforce
Developers, and the Senior Salesforce Administrator to assist with
implementation of new processes, integrations, and components.
Establish and maintain regular written and verbal communications with
department heads, end-u , and the Data Services team regarding Salesforce
activities and projects through various mechanisms including daily stand-ups,
one-on-ones, and technical applications (e.g. Teams, Jira, Smartsheet, etc.)
Critically evaluate and document information gathered during needs discovery
sessions.
Support small to medium system changes and implementations, including
design, development, testing, UAT, training, roll-out, and on-going maintenance
